如何快速高效对接PG电子怎么对接PG电子

如何快速高效对接PG电子

  1. PG电子概述
  2. 开发环境的准备
  3. 配置PG电子
  4. 测试连接
  5. 优化

在现代Web开发中,PostgreSQL(PG电子)作为功能强大、性能优越的开源数据库,被广泛应用于Web开发项目中,如何快速高效地对接PG电子,是许多开发者在项目初期需要解决的问题,本文将从多个角度详细阐述如何快速对接PG电子,帮助开发者顺利完成数据库对接。


PG电子概述

PG电子(PostgreSQL电子版)是PostgreSQL的一个轻量级版本,特别适合Web开发场景,它不仅保留了PostgreSQL的核心功能,还优化了针对Web应用的性能,适合开发人员快速上手,以下是PG电子的主要特点:

  • 轻量级设计:PG电子去除了PostgreSQL部分不必要的组件,降低了启动时间和资源消耗。
  • 高性能:优化了PostgreSQL的查询性能,特别适合处理高并发Web应用。
  • 易用性:提供了友好的Web界面和命令行工具,方便开发者进行管理和维护。

了解了PG电子的特点后,我们就可以开始学习如何对接它了。


开发环境的准备

在开始对接PG电子之前,我们需要为开发环境准备好必要的工具和配置。

1 安装Node.js

Node.js 是一个轻量级的JavaScript引擎,广泛用于Web开发,PG电子需要Node.js来运行,安装Node.js的命令如下:

npm install node@14.x

运行以下命令验证Node.js是否安装成功:

node -v

2 安装NPM

NPM 是Node.js的包管理器,用于安装和管理开发工具,安装NPM的命令如下:

npm install

运行以下命令验证NPM是否安装成功:

npm -v

3 安装PostgreSQL

PostgreSQL 是PG电子的核心数据库,我们需要安装PostgreSQL并配置它来支持PG电子,安装PostgreSQL的命令如下:

sudo apt-get install postgresql postgresql-contrib

运行以下命令验证PostgreSQL是否安装成功:

sudo systemctl status postgresql

4 配置环境变量

为了确保PostgreSQL能够与Node.js和PG电子顺利通信,我们需要配置一些环境变量,以下是常用的环境变量:

  • PG输入参数:PostgreSQL连接到外部数据库的参数,需要根据实际情况配置。
PG输入参数=-U postgres -d mydb -p password

将以上参数保存到 ~/.bashrc 文件中,以确保每次登录时都能自动加载。


配置PG电子

在准备好开发环境后,我们可以开始配置PG电子了。

1 配置PG电子的环境变量

PG电子需要一些环境变量来配置其行为,以下是常用的环境变量:

  • NODE_ENV:指定开发环境,值可以是 developmenttestproduction
  • REACT_APP:指定React项目的根目录。
  • REACT_APP_API_URL:指定React API的URL。
  • REACT_APP PERSISTENCE:指定React应用的持久化配置。

将以下环境变量设置为:

NODE_ENV=development
REACT_APP=/path/to/your/react-project
REACT_APP_API_URL=http://localhost:3000
REACT_APP PERSISTENCE=/path/to/your-react-project/persistence

保存到 ~/.bashrc 文件中。

2 配置PG电子的配置文件

PG电子的配置文件位于 ~/.pg电子/config 文件夹中,我们需要在这里定义一些基本配置参数,以下是示例配置文件:

[pg电子]
driver = postgres
host = 127.0.0.1
port = 5432
database = mydb
user = postgres
password = password
[pg电子 extra]
pg电子 extra host = 127.0.0.1
pg电子 extra port = 5432
pg电子 extra database = mydb
pg电子 extra user = postgres
pg电子 extra password = password

将以上配置文件保存到 ~/.pg电子/config 文件夹中。


测试连接

在配置完成后,我们需要测试一下PG电子是否能够正确连接到PostgreSQL。

1 编写测试用例

编写一个简单的Node.js脚本,用于测试PG电子的连接,脚本如下:

const pg电子 = require('pg电子');
pg电子()
  .connect({
    host: '127.0.0.1',
    port: 5432,
    database: 'mydb',
    user: 'postgres',
    password: 'password'
  })
  .send('Hello, World!');

将此脚本保存为 test-connect.js 文件。

2 执行测试用例

运行以下命令执行测试用例:

node test-connect.js

如果连接成功,会输出 Hello, World! 到控制台。

3 设置环境变量

在测试过程中,我们需要设置一些环境变量来模拟实际的应用场景。

export REACT_APP=/path/to/your/react-project
export REACT_APP_API_URL=http://localhost:3000
export REACT_APP PERSISTENCE=/path/to/your-react-project/persistence

将以上命令添加到 ~/.pg电子/profile/reaction-app.conf 文件中。


优化

在对接成功后,我们需要对PG电子进行一些优化,以提升应用的性能。

1 使用索引

PostgreSQL 提供了索引功能,可以显著提高查询性能,在数据库表中创建索引,可以将查询时间从 O(N) 降为 O(log N)。

2 使用pg电子的高级功能

pg电子提供了许多高级功能,

  • pg电子的记录式存储:可以将PostgreSQL的记录保存到本地文件中,提高应用的可扩展性。
  • pg电子的事务管理:可以更高效地管理事务,避免数据不一致的问题。

通过以上优化措施,可以进一步提升应用的性能。


如何快速高效对接PG电子指南至此结束,希望本文能够帮助开发者顺利完成PG电子的对接,为后续的开发工作打下坚实的基础。

发表评论